From salary of Rs 10,000 per month as per second schedule of constitution to salary of Rs 500,000 per month as per 2018 union budget of India the President of India tops the list of highest salary to an Government official in India. The President of India who is head of India and commander in chief of Indian Armed Forces is entitled with highest salary of Rs 500,000 per month. The Vice President of India with salary of Rs 400,000 per month holds second position and Governor of states with salary of Rs 350,000 holds third position. Other than salary Government official are given Retirement benefits, travel cost, medical expenses and many other allowances.

President of India₹ 5,00,000
Vice President of India₹ 4,00,000
Prime Minister of India₹ 1,00,000
Governor of States₹ 3,50,000
Chief Justice of India₹ 2,80,000
Chief Election Commissioner of India₹ 2,50,000
Controller and Auditor General of India₹ 2,50,000
Chairman of Union Public Service Commission₹ 2,50,000
Judges of Supreme Court of India₹ 2,50,000
Cabinet Secretary of India₹ 2,50,000
Lieutenants Governors of Union Territories₹ 1,10,000
Chief of Staff (Army, Navy, Air Force)₹ 2,50,000
Chief Justice of High Courts₹ 2,50,000
Judges of High Courts₹ 2,25,000
Member of Parliament of India₹ 1,00,000
Secretaries to Government of India₹ 2,25,000
Chief Secretaries of State Government₹ 2,25,000
Additional Secretaries to Government of IndiaBetween ₹ 1,82,200 to ₹ 2,24,000
Principal Secretaries to State GovernmentBetween ₹ 1,82,200 to ₹ 2,24,000
Joint Secretaries to Government of IndiaBetween ₹ 1,44,200 to ₹ 2,18,000
Secretaries to State GovernmentBetween ₹ 1,44,200 to ₹ 2,18,000


